EDU 358 Week 3 Assignment
Scoring Rubric Development - Liner Equation functions

Linear Equations
Distinguished
4 pts
Proficient
3 pts
Basic
2 pts
Below Expectations
1 pts
Non-Performance
0 pts
Identification of variables
Distinguished
Correctly identifies and matches equation variables with 100% accuracy (4 of 4).
Proficient
Correctly identifies and matches equation variables with 75% accuracy (3 of 4).
Basic
Correctly identifies and matches equation variables with 50% accuracy (2 of 4).
Below Expectations
Correctly identifies and matches equation variables with 25% accuracy (1 of 4).
Non-Performance
Does not correctly identify or match equation variables.
Correct sequence of variables
Distinguished
Correctly constructs the sequence of variables in slope-intercept form with 100% accuracy (4 of 4).
Proficient
Correctly constructs the sequence of variables in slope-intercept form with 75% accuracy (3 of 4).
Basic
Correctly constructs the sequence of variables in slope-intercept form with 50% accuracy (2 of 4).
Below Expectations
Does not correctly construct the sequence of variables in slope-intercept form.
Non-Performance
No evidence of work.
Graphing with two sequential (x,y) points
Distinguished
Correctly graphs a Linear Equation function with both (x,y) points plotted correctly with the correct slope. Points are connected on the graph.
Proficient
Partially graphs a Linear Equation function with both (x,y) points plotted correctly with the correct slope. Points are NOT connected on the graph.
Basic
Partially graphs a Linear Equation function with one (x,y) points plotted correctly with the correct slope, and one incorrectly plotted.
Below Expectations
Incorrectly graphs a Linear Equation function with no (x,y) points plotted correctly.
Non-Performance
No evidence of work.
Worksheet Completion
Distinguished
Worksheet is 80-100% completed (4 or 5 of 5 items completed).
Proficient
Worksheet is 60% completed (3 of 5 items completed).
Basic
Worksheet is 40% completed (2 of 5 items completed).
Below Expectations
Worksheet is 20% completed (1 of 5 items completed).
Non-Performance
Worksheet is not completed (0 of 5 items completed).
Analytical Thinking
Distinguished
Applies Linear equation rules to analyze the slope-intercept form. Shows full work.
Proficient
Applies Linear equation rules to analyze the slope-intercept form.
Basic
Partially applies Linear equation rules to analyze the slope-intercept form.
Below Expectations
Minimal application of Linear equation rules to analyze the slope-intercept form.
Non-Performance
No evidence of analytical thinking.
